Right, so in my previous post I embedded the vid of my first backflip via twitvid.com, however what would I do if I wanted to download that? Heres a guide on how to download vids from twitvid!
1.
Goto the page of the video you wanna download, see the URL bit up top, well in this case its ” http://www.twitvid.com/A7C51 “, well just ” player/” after the “twitvid.com”, so it’d be “http://www.twitvid.com/player/A7C51″, hit enter an go it.
2.
righto, so you’ll be brought to this page, its basically a big screen flash player of the vid, the url will now be something ridonkcolously, pick out the http://www.twitvid.com/playVideo_A7C51/token_87c55b1e07b6647e6e7bf172b6585ef0
copy and paste it into the url bar and go to it!
3.
Right, so this is the movie file playing in your browser, its a .mp4 (MPEG4) file, so you can right click the page and save as, or goto the ‘edit’ tab and save page as, or what ever!
Now you can download and do whatever the hell you want!
